What is a dog house in Minecraft?
A dog house is a small structure where a tamed wolf can rest. It protects the pet from enemies and accidents. Some players call it a kennel, pet shelter, or dog pen. These homes can be simple or detailed, depending on creativity. Players build dog houses using different materials like wood, stone, or bricks. Some add details like food bowls (trapdoors or cauldrons) and fences.
How to make a dog house in Minecraft
Dog houses come in many styles. A basic one has a wooden frame, a roof, and an open entrance. Players often use wooden planks, stairs, and slabs. Carpets or wool can serve as a bed.
For a more creative build, players use quartz, bricks, or glass. Some design modern houses, treehouse shelters, or underground dens. The key is to make it safe and comfortable for the pet. Adding torches or lanterns keeps the area bright and prevents hostile mobs. Fences can stop the dog from wandering too far. Again, it is Minecraft, so you have almost all the freedom in the world. Simple Dog House
Materials
- Oak Logs
- Red Wool
- Red Carpet
- Oak Fence Gate
- Oak Planks
- Glowstone (or any light source)
- Item Frame
- Bone

How to build
- Place two oak logs on top of each other, leaving a three-block gap between them.
- Repeat on the opposite side to form a square base.
- Fill the floor with red wool and place red carpet on top.
- Install oak fence gates between the logs on all four sides.
- Build a sloped roof with oak planks, extending one block outwards on each side.
- Add a glowstone underneath the roof for lighting.
- Place an item frame above the entrance and put a bone inside.

Small Dog House
Materials
- Deepslate Tile Walls
- Gray Stained Glass Panes
- Spruce Fence Gate
- Spruce Stairs
- Spruce Slabs
- Lantern

How to build
- Build the walls using deepslate tile walls to enclose a small area.
- Add gray stained glass panes on three sides to create windows.
- Place a spruce fence gate as the entrance.
- Construct a sloped roof using spruce stairs, placing three stairs on each side.
- Attach spruce slabs along the peak of the roof for a trim detail.
- Place a lantern at the center of the roof for lighting.

Brick and Oak Dog House
Materials
- Oak Logs
- Oak Planks
- Polished Andesite
- White Wool
- Oak Stairs
- Stone Bricks
- Iron Bars
- Birch Fence Gate
- Cauldron
- Chest

How to build
- Form the base with an oak log “8” shape, leaving a three-block gap for storage.
- Lay polished andesite at the entrance and fill the floor with white wool.
- Build two-block high walls around the structure.
- Use upside-down oak stairs to create a doorway arch.
- Place oak planks on top for the roof base.
- Add overlapping stone bricks to build the sloped roof.
- Install upside-down oak stairs under the roof edges for detailing.
- Position a chest and cauldron in the designated gaps.
- Enclose the area with iron bars and a birch fence gate.

How to make a doggy door in Minecraft
You can create a small doggy door to help your dog move in and out of your house. Here is how to do it:
- Break a 1x2 space in your wall or fence.
- Place a trapdoor or a fence gate in that space.
- Add a pressure plate if you want the door to open by itself.
- Make your dog follow you to go through the door.
How do you make a dog bed in Minecraft?
There is no real dog bed in Minecraft, but you can build one using basic blocks. It helps you create a cozy space for your dog. Here’s how:
- Place wool blocks or carpet on the floor.
- Use slabs or signs around the wool to shape the bed.
- Add a bone or an item frame nearby to decorate the area.
- Put the bed inside your house or next to your pet area.
